In the Daisy and greater Ozark County area, professional installation typically ranges from $3 to $12 per square foot, heavily dependent on material choice and job complexity. Key factors include the flooring type (luxury vinyl plank vs. hardwood), the condition of your subfloor, and the home's layout. Local material availability can also affect cost, as transporting specialty products to our rural area may add to the overall price.
Daisy's humid summers and variable winters make dimensional stability a top priority. We recommend materials like luxury vinyl plank (LVP) or engineered hardwood that are designed to withstand humidity changes better than solid hardwood, which can expand and contract significantly. Proper acclimation of materials in your home for 48-72 hours before installation is a critical step local installers must follow to prevent future warping or gaps.

Late spring and early fall are ideal in Daisy, as moderate temperatures and lower humidity allow for optimal material acclimation and adhesive curing. A typical single-room installation (e.g., a living room) takes 1-2 days, while a whole-house project may take 3-5 days. Scheduling ahead is crucial, especially before the holiday season, as local installer availability can be limited.
